Putri Kusuma Sanjiwani, S.H., M.H.,


She was born in Denpasar, Indonesia, on December 29, 1988. She earned her Bachelor of Laws degree from the Faculty of Law, Udayana University, in 2011. In the same year, she commenced her Master’s studies in Law and successfully completed the Master of Law Program at Udayana University in 2015.

Currently, she is a lecturer at the Faculty of Tourism, Udayana University, with academic interests focusing on tourism law and tourism policy. Her research portfolio includes notable studies such as: The Authority of the Provincial Government of Bali in the Development of Tourism Ports as a Support for Bali Tourism (2015); Legal Regulation of Beach Border Privatization by Tourism Entrepreneurs in Bali Province (2016); Intellectual Property Rights in the Tourism Industry (Case Study: Legal Protection for the Utilization of Local Genius in Local Entrepreneurs’ Products) (2016); The Exploitation of Goa Pindul as Speleo Tourism in Gunung Kidul, Yogyakarta (2017); Government Policy in the Development of Agrotourism in Disaster-Prone Areas in Karangasem Regency (2018); and Breach of Contract in Overseas Travel Agreements by Indonesian Tourists (2019).
